Lafayette woman charged in Crowley drive-by shooting

CROWLEY, La. (KLFY) -- A Lafayette woman has been arrested in connection with a drive-by shooting in Crowley, authorities said.

Johnesha Fontenot, 18 of Lafayette is charged with eight counts of principal to attempted second degree murder in connection with an incident on Jan. 28.

Crowley Police reported a shooting in the 300 block of West Andrus in the Shady Oaks subdivision at approximately 2:15 a.m. Jan. 28. Authorities said a man was sitting in his vehicle when he was ambushed by an unidentified shooter.

Investigators said the vehicle was hit nine times, and the man was shot in the hand. The victim was hospitalized with non-life-threanening injuries, officials said.

During the course of the incident, two vehicles were struck by gunfire, and the victim's residence was also damaged. A neighboring apartment was also affected when a bullet penetrated the wall and struck the main water line, causing in the roof of the apartment to collapse, officials said.

The investigation is ongoing, officials said. Anyone with information about this incident is asked to contact Crowley Police at 337-783-1234.
